Free coaching classes for UPSC/NPSC aspirants in Mon

Morung Express News
Mon | January 20
 

As circulated around in the social media and as informed to the public in the churches about the free UPSC/NPSC coaching classes for interested aspirants, the District Administrative Officers Mon conducted an orientation workshop in preparing for civil service examination at the DC's Conference Hall, Mon on January 19.  

The introduction about the class and number of post in the UPSC examination every year in India and the seats reserved for Northeast India was enlightened to the aspirants by SDO(C) Reny Wilfred, IAS. The Deputy Commissioner, Mon, K Thavaseelan, IAS presented the power point on the syllabus of UPSC, its subject under the three different course of exams and where to get about its materials.  

Assistant Commissioner Mon, Abhinav Shivam, IAS delivered an encouraging speech where he shared on how to switch the mindset from ‘we can't make it’ to ‘we can make it’ setting an example of how he himself cracked the exam.  

The free classes will be held every Friday from 3:00 to 4:00 pm and it will be conducted by the administrative officers themselves.  

As far as the UPSC/NPSC coaching classes is concerned, it is also learned that they are collaborating with Shankar IAS Academy (SIA) and the founder D. Shankar has graciously agreed to send 10 sets of their UPSC and other competitive exam study materials to the district completely free of cost.  

These 10 sets of UPSC materials from the Shankar IAS Academy will be in the office library which will be shortly opened opposite to the DC's chamber and any aspirant can come can come and read during any office hours but the materials will not be allowed to go out of the office since its limited in number, they said. A total number of 80-90 aspirants attended the first day of the class.
